The boy endures this nightmare in silence, believing there is no escape. His only respite arrives in the form of a handwritten note tucked into his desk. The note writer, revealing herself to be his female classmate Kojima, is also a victim of bullying. She is described as being dark-skinned and unbathed, and she is tormented for her uncleanliness. The two outcasts begin a secret correspondence, then secret meetings, forming a fragile and precious friendship.

The novel contrasts Kojima's belief system with the terrifying nihilism of the bullies. In a pivotal conversation, the narrator asks one of his tormentors, Momose, if their cruelty has any meaning. Momose's chilling response reveals a terrifying worldview: "None of this has any meaning. Everyone does what they want. Nothing is good or bad. There was something they wanted to do, and they did it." This contrasts starkly with Kojima's search for purpose in pain.
